Planet Earth Education Edition Honored with 2008 Distinguished Achievement Award

Discovery Education Earns Four Awards from Association of Educational Publishers

Silver Spring, MD (June 9, 2008) – On June 6, Discovery Education’s outstanding Planet Earth Education Edition was honored by The Association of Educational Publishers (AEP) with a 2008 Distinguished Achievement Award. The AEP is a national, nonprofit professional organization for educational publishers and content developers.

The Planet Earth Education Edition combines the highly acclaimed Planet Earth series from Discovery Channel with a variety of educational resources. The DVD set includes 14 programs chaptered into core-concept clips, including Pole to Pole, Fresh Water, The Future: Saving Species, Deserts and more. In addition, the set includes more than 30 teacher’s guides spanning grades 3-12. Each guide provides educators with learning objectives, discussion questions, academic standards, and more than 30 writing prompts to spur student cr eativity. The package also contains 11 animal guides and posters in PDF format, sized for printing-on-demand. Planet Earth also is available online through Discovery Education streaming Plus.

Discovery Education Health and the Allstate ‘Drive It Right’ program were also honored with Distinguished Achievement awards, while Discovery Educati on’s Corporate Brochure received a Beacon Award.

‘Drive It Right’ is a powerful video that delivers the important message of teen safe driving – from teens who have firsthand experience with car crashes. The DVD was used in a co-branded Discovery Education and Allstate campaign to promote safe driving practices.

Discovery Education Health is an online health and prevention resource for K-12 educators. Offering 16 curriculum programs that cover nine key topic areas as well as a collection of videos, lessons, teacher's guides and worksheets, Discovery Education Health is currently used in classrooms nationwide.
